java



JAVA/Agent.t mi infetta Windows 7 64bit, grazie Java di Merda!!

| | |

Diciamoci la verità, questo benedetto Sun Java (ora Oracle) non serve una cippa. O meglio serve perché le università e le cosìdette enterprise lo usano perché fa fico occupare tanta ram e usare Eclipse per realizzare programmi tipo "Hello World".


Ma per la stragrande maggioranza degli abitanti di questo pianeta JAVA NON SERVE A UN CAZZO!!!
L'idea iniziale era buona, fai un software che funziona su tutte le piattaforme e lo compili una volta sola, ma nella pratica fai un software che fa cagare per tutte le piattaforme.

  • Animazioni web? Applet Java! Ma va, Flash..
  • SW Multipiattaforma? SWT + un blocco di RAM! Ma va, WxWidgets, gtk, qt, c, python.. Vedi GIMP e Amule come sono fatti!
  • Web2.0? Nah PHP, Python e Ruby sono molto meglio

Quindi che a che serve Java?
A prendere virus via browser

Cronaca dell'infezione da virus

Cerco un software per modificare i file .MOV su Windows, Google mi rimpalla su varie directory spazzatura e una di queste mi sodomizza il PC con un .class che a sua volta scarica altri virus che si spacciano da Antivirus.
Non è finita, la distribuzione di virus fa sì che:
  • CTRL+ALT+CANC venga disabilitato
  • apre un proxy server sulla macchina locale che risolve tutti gli indirizzi con quelli dell'antivirus fasullo
  • disabilita regedit e aggiornamenti di Windows
  • e chiude l'antivirus AVIRA ogni volta che prova ad avviarsi!!!
  • avvia se stesso ogni volta che uno apre Internet Explorer (non è il mio caso)
  • e altre porcate come inviare tuoi file in giro (esempio le password salvate di IE8)

Ripristino

Un gran casino, fortuna che dalla modalità provvisoria, si riesce a riaprire regedit togliere lui e i suoi fratelli dall'avvio e risistemare il tutto (disabilitare il proxy fasullo, aggiornare l'antivirus vero,..)

Curioso come questa variante sia stata catalogata da Avira solo ieri.
PS: forse non era abbastanza esplicito ma correte a disabilitare gli applet Java nel vostro browser! (Soprattutto se dovete usare Windows)

Noo pure il video java vs .net censurato dalla Alley Corp

|

Se sapete un po' d'inglese e conoscete java e .net dovete vedere questo video.. prima che venga censurato di nuovo :(

http://www.youtube.com/watch?v=sPr46taKjA4
fonte: http://jz10.java.no/java-4-ever-trailer.html


Oss..iniuuuur Ubuntu 8.10 con java di default

| |

https://lists.ubuntu.com/archives/ubuntu-devel-announce/2008-July/000460.html

spero proprio non ci sia nel cd di installazione, altrimenti ci saranno più VM e linguaggi di programmazione, invece che software.. (Mono .NET, python, perl,..)

desktop : java = la bella : alla bestia
Il bello delle applicazioni java è che sono pachidermiche e totalmente non integrate col desktop in cui si trovano.


Quelle volte che ti girano le xcb_xlib_unlock...

|

$ ./bin/xmaple
Locking assertion failure. Backtrace:
#0 /usr/lib/libxcb-xlib.so.0 [0xb092a767]
#1 /usr/lib/libxcb-xlib.so.0(xcb_xlib_unlock+0x31) [0xb092a8b1]
#2 /usr/lib/libX11.so.6(_XReply+0xfd) [0xb096f29d]
#3 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/xawt/libmawt.so [0xb0a5fa76]
#4 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/xawt/libmawt.so [0xb0a4580a]
#5 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/xawt/libmawt.so [0xb0a45a51]
#6 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/xawt/libmawt.so(Java_sun_awt_X11GraphicsEnvironment_initDisplay+0x24) [0xb0a45c5c]
#7 [0xb2a86b6a]
#8 [0xb2a80a7b]
#9 [0xb2a80a7b]
#10 [0xb2a7e157]
#11 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/client/libjvm.so [0xb778dfec]
#12 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/client/libjvm.so [0xb789b1f8]
#13 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/client/libjvm.so [0xb778de1f]
#14 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/client/libjvm.so(JVM_DoPrivileged+0x32d) [0xb77eb4bd]
#15 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/libjava.so(Java_java_security_AccessController_doPrivileged__Ljava_security_PrivilegedAction_2+0x3d) [0xb75982cd]
#16 [0xb2a8641b]
#17 [0xb2a809a4]
#18 [0xb2a7e157]
#19 /media/hdb1/maple/jre.IBM_INTEL_LINUX/lib/i386/client/libjvm.so [0xb778dfec]
java: xcb_xlib.c:82: xcb_xlib_unlock: Assertion `c->xlib.lock' failed.
Aborted (core dumped)

Cosa vorrà mai dire questo errore?

Ehm.. chiediamolo a google. Dopo varie letture di forum, patch improvvisate di libmawt.so e altre cose bizzarre, si arriva alla conclusione che voleva solo:

export LIBXCB_ALLOW_SLOPPY_LOCK=true

quindi mettete anche questa variabile d'ambiente in /etc/environment

Vedi anche:
https://bugs.launchpad.net/ubuntu/+source/sun-java6/+bug/87947


Syndicate content